Sterility Test Isolators – A Deep Dive

Sterility evaluation isolators are increasingly essential components within pharmaceutical manufacturing environments. These specialized enclosures offer a stringent environment, reducing the risk of bacterial contamination in sterility protocols. Grasping the principles behind isolator functioning is crucial for maintaining product safety. Significant considerations include fabrication selection, ventilation systems, disinfection validation, and staff training.

In conclusion, sterility isolators function as a foundation of microbial-free medicinal substance confidence.

Compounding with Assurance: The Function of Clean Isolators

In modern medicinal compounding, achieving reliable product purity is critical. Conventional methods often present challenges to maintain the necessary level of asepsis, increasing the chance of adulteration. Sterile enclosures offer a major answer, providing a physically contained environment for blending operations. These devices lessen operator exposure with the substance, and effectively prevent environmental influences from compromising the final dosage, fostering greater confidence in the safety and potency of the compounded drug.

Maintaining Aseptic Isolator Integrity and Performance

Ensuring reliable sterile isolator operation demands thorough evaluation protocols . This includes regular inspection of glove soundness , leak testing – typically employing air mass spectrometers – and confirmation of airflow distribution . Proactive servicing programs are vital to mitigate likely breakdowns preceding they influence product purity . Furthermore, user training on appropriate isolator manipulation and cleaning techniques is fundamental for preserving dependable isolator reliability .
